Australian beach volleyballer sells tattoo space on her body to fund Olympic dream
Mike Pollitt | Tuesday 28 June, 2011 16:25
Top Aussie beach volleyballer [Claire] Kelly is so committed to getting her and partner Carla Kleverlaan to the Olympics that she’s selling tattoo space on her body for sponsors. For $10,000 you can have a 2cm x 2cm piece of Kelly’s toned and tanned left limb, while $50,000 buys 5cm x 5cm on her right arm or shoulder. There are other … um, packages, for between $10,000 and $50,000 and an eBay auction.
You’ve got to hand it to the Aussies. They may be crap at cricket, but they know how to run a publicity stunt.
